Hiroshi Yamauchi
3f0de5787e Add the inreg attribute to sreg when present.
On Windows/AArch64, a different register is used between when an
arugment is both inreg and sret (X0 or X1) and when it is just sret
(X8) as the following comment indicates:

46fe36a429/llvm/lib/Target/AArch64/AArch64CallingConvention.td (L42)

```
  // In AAPCS, an SRet is passed in X8, not X0 like a normal pointer parameter.
  // However, on windows, in some circumstances, the SRet is passed in X0 or X1
  // instead.  The presence of the inreg attribute indicates that SRet is
  // passed in the alternative register (X0 or X1), not X8:
  // - X0 for non-instance methods.
  // - X1 for instance methods.

  // The "sret" attribute identifies indirect returns.
  // The "inreg" attribute identifies non-aggregate types.
  // The position of the "sret" attribute identifies instance/non-instance
  // methods.
  // "sret" on argument 0 means non-instance methods.
  // "sret" on argument 1 means instance methods.

  CCIfInReg<CCIfType<[i64],
        CCIfSRet<CCIfType<[i64], CCAssignToReg<[X0, X1]>>>>>,

  CCIfSRet<CCIfType<[i64], CCAssignToReg<[X8]>>>,
```

So missing/dropping inreg can cause a codegen bug.

This is a partial fix for #74866

Arnold Schwaighofer
eaf90dff38 IRGen: Add metadata for async funclets denoting frame entry and frame exists
Adds sections `__TEXT,__swift_as_entry`, and `__TEXT,__swift_as_ret` that
contain relative pointers to async functlets modelling async function entries,
and function returns, respectively.

Emission of the sections can be trigger with the frontend option
`-Xfrontend -enable-async-frame-push-pop-metadata`.

This is done by:

* IRGen adding a `async_entry` function attribute to async functions.
* LLVM's coroutine splitting identifying continuation funclets that
  model the return from an async function call by adding the function
  attribute `async_ret`.  (see #llvm-project/pull/9204)
* An LLVM pass that keys off these two function attribute and emits the
  metadata into the above mention sections.

Akira Hatanaka
42bc49d3fe Add a new parameter convention @in_cxx for non-trivial C++ classes that are passed indirectly and destructed by the caller (#73019)
This corresponds to the parameter-passing convention of the Itanium C++
ABI, in which the argument is passed indirectly and possibly modified,
but not destroyed, by the callee.

@in_cxx is handled the same way as @in in callers and @in_guaranteed in
callees. OwnershipModelEliminator emits the call to destroy_addr that is
needed to destroy the argument in the caller.

John McCall
0a282c044f Unify all of the task-creation builtins coming out of SILGen.
We've been building up this exponential explosion of task-creation
builtins because it's not currently possible to overload builtins.
As long as all of the operands are scalar, though, it's pretty easy
to peephole optional injections in IRGen, which means we can at
least just use a single builtin in SIL and then break it apart in
IRGen to decide which options to set.

I also eliminated the metadata argument, which can easily be recreated
from the substitutions.  I also added proper verification for the builtin,
which required (1) getting `@Sendable` right more consistently and (2)
updating a bunch of tests checking for things that are not actually
valid, like passing a function that returns an Int directly.

Alastair Houghton
d0c35cf2d5 [IRGen] Don't call objc_retainAutoreleasedReturnValue() without interop.
When ObjC interop is not enabled, we shouldn't be emitting calls to
`objc_retainAutoreleasedReturnValue()` as that function might not exist.

Call `swift_retain()` instead, to balance the `swift_release()` of the
returned value.

Fixes #47846, #45359.

Akira Hatanaka
b3f302b96b [IRGen] Fix a bug where an argument wasn't annotated with sret (#71459)
Fix a bug in expandExternalSignatureTypes where it wasn't annotating a function call parameter type with sret when the result was being returned indirectly.

The bug was causing calls to ObjC methods that return their results indirectly to crash.

Additionally, fix the return type for C++ constructors computed in expandExternalSignatureTypes. Previously, the return type was always void even on targets that require constructors to return this (e.g., Apple arm64), which was causing C++ constructor thunks to be emitted needlessly.

Alastair Houghton
143a473aa4 [Runtime][IRGen] Trap C++ exceptions on *throw*, not catch.
The previous approach was effectively to catch the exception and then
run a trap instruction.  That has the unfortunate feature that we end
up with a crash at the catch site, not at the throw site, which leaves
us with very little information about which exception was thrown or
where from.

(Strictly we do have the exception pointer and could obtain exception
information, but it still won't tell us what threw it.)

Instead of that, set a personality function for Swift functions that
call potentially throwing code, and have that personality function
trap the exception during phase 1 (i.e. *before* the original stack
has been unwound).
